Over the objections of the oil and gas industry, two environmental groups are asking the federal government to protect a tiny West Texas reptile amid the failure of a state-crafted plan to conserve it. The Center for Biological Diversity and Defenders of Wildlife petitioned the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service on May 8 to list the dunes sagebrush lizard as threatened or endangered under the federal Endangered Species Act. –The Texas Tribune Read more…
